Published values of G derived from high-precision measurements since the 1950s have remained compatible with Heyl (1930), but within the relative uncertainty of about 0.1% (or 1,000 ppm) have varied rather broadly, and it is not entirely clear if the uncertainty has been reduced at all since the 1942 measurement. Visa mer The gravitational constant (also known as the universal gravitational constant, the Newtonian constant of gravitation, or the Cavendish gravitational constant), denoted by the capital letter G, is an empirical physical constant involved … Visa mer The gravitational constant is a physical constant that is difficult to measure with high accuracy. This is because the gravitational force is an extremely weak force as compared to other fundamental forces at the laboratory scale. Webb2. Account for the differences between the experimental value and the theoretical values for the standard enthalpies of combustion. In the experiment, not all of the heat produced was used in heating the water. Some of the heat was lost to the surroundings (heating the copper can and the air around the flame).

Haemoglobin oxygen capacity is expressed by the maximum volume of oxygen that combines with 1 g of haemoglobin – Hüfner's constant. The theoretical, i.e. calculated value, of the Hüfner's constant is 1.39 ml g −1.
